A Large Colony. Twelve hundred Welsh Baptists recently left New York on their way to settle upon a large tract of land near Kuoxville, Teiin., purchased for them by agents previously sent over. Several eutire churches came, and three of their pastors. These preach- i ci-3 are educated men, and able to preach in Engli-h as well as Welsh, but most of the colony speak and read ! tiiiiy iici-n.
